About ICE CREAM
ICE CREAM is a moderate-calorie food with 212 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is carbohydrates, providing 3.0g of protein, 25.8g of carbohydrates, and 10.6g of fat. This food belongs to the Ice Cream & Frozen Yogurt category.
Ingredients
MILK, CREAM, CORN SYRUP, SUGAR, WHEY, NONFAT MILK, COCOA PROCESSED WITH ALKALI, CELLULOSE GEL, CELLULOSE GUM, MONO & DIGLYCERIDES, NATURAL AND ARTIFICIAL FLAVORS, CARRAGEENAN, VANILLA BEAN.
Calorie Breakdown
At 212 calories per 100 grams, ICE CREAM gets 6% of its calories from protein, 49% from carbohydrates, and 45% from fat. This is moderately high, similar to many cooked grains and dairy products.
